There is an error in the third sentence of the second paragraph of the Introduction. The correct sentence is: “In Puerto Rico, cancer was the second leading cause of death by 2010 [8], and cervical cancer accounts for 3.9% of all cancer cases [9].”

There are errors in Table 1. The numbers from the 34%/13% scenario are repeated for the 50%/40% and 80%/64% scenarios. In addition, I the 80%/64% scenario, the years have an inverted order. Please see the corrected Table 1 here.
